These parts get are no sparks or flames. Do not smoke. extremely hot from operahon, even after the ...Wrong Fuel Mix. String trimmers use either a 2-stroke or 4-stroke engine. A 2-stroke engine requires a mixture of oil and gas, typically at a 40:1 ratio. Some models might use a 50:1 mix so check your manual. The mixture has to be exactly at the right ratio. A slight mistake can have a significant effect on the engine.

The most common mistake made is using the wrong ratio. Two-stroke weed eaters use a 40:1 or 50:1 fuel ratio. If this is not followed, the engine might stall when you run it at full throttle. In some cases it might not start at all. The other potential problem is using fuel with more than 10% ethanol.

If you use an incorrect ratio, it may result in inappropriate engine combustion, excess smoke emission or damage to the ...The correct oil to gas ratio for a Craftsman weed eater is 40:1. This means you should mix 3.2 ounces of oil for every gallon of gasoline. It is important to use a 2-cycle engine oil that is specifically recommended by Craftsman for optimal performance and to prevent engine damage. For two-cycle handheld engines produced after 2003: Use a 40-to-1 ratio (to aid in the reduction of emissions). This can be made by mixing 3.2 ounces of two-cycle engine oil with 1 gallon of gasoline. If you are unsure of the year your equipment was made: Use the 40:1 mixture. I removed the magneto completely and was about to replace it, but decided to put it back on after a few ...The fuel-oil mixture ratio for all Weed Eater products is 40:1. You can obtain this ratio by mixing 3.2 oz. of two cycle air cooled engine oil with one gallon of regular gas. Over a period of time oil will separate from gasoline.
